Who Is Air Peace?

Air Peace is Nigeria's largest airline, founded in 2013 and headquartered in Lagos. The airline operates scheduled passenger and charter services across Nigeria, West Africa, the Middle East, Southern Africa, and the United Kingdom. As a member of the Spring Alliance (alongside Arik Air, Aero Contractors, Azman Air, United Nigeria, and MaxAir), Air Peace plays a major role in Nigeria's domestic aviation market.

  • Hub: Murtala Muhammed International Airport (LOS), Lagos, Nigeria
  • Headquarters: Lagos, Nigeria
  • Fleet Size: 23 aircraft including Boeing 737-300, Embraer E145, Boeing 737 MAX 8, Embraer E195-E2, and Boeing 787 Dreamliners (for the Lagos–London Gatwick service)
  • Destinations: Over 30 domestic and international destinations
  • IATA Code: P4
  • Tagline: Your Peace, Our Goal
  • Alliance: Spring Alliance (Nigerian carrier consortium)

What Cabin Classes Does Air Peace Offer?

  • Economy Class — Comfortable seating with friendly cabin service, complimentary refreshments on most flights, and access to in-flight entertainment on long-haul aircraft. The most popular cabin for travellers booking Air Peace online.
  • Business Class — Available on selected aircraft and long-haul services (notably the Lagos–London Gatwick route on Boeing 787 Dreamliners). Includes priority boarding, enhanced baggage allowance, premium dining, and lounge access at major airports.

Which Destinations Does Air Peace Serve?

Air Peace flights cover an expanding network across Nigeria, West Africa, the Middle East, Southern Africa, and Europe. Popular routes for travellers to fly Air Peace:

Domestic (Nigeria)

  • Lagos (LOS) — The hub
  • Abuja (ABV) — Multiple daily flights, the busiest Air Peace route
  • Port Harcourt (PHC) — Daily services
  • Kano (KAN) — Frequent daily flights
  • Owerri, Enugu, Asaba, Benin City, Kaduna, Sokoto, Yola, Calabar, Uyo — Extensive domestic coverage

International

  • Ghana: Accra
  • The Gambia: Banjul
  • Senegal: Dakar
  • Sierra Leone: Freetown
  • Liberia: Monrovia
  • UAE: Sharjah
  • South Africa: Johannesburg
  • United Kingdom: London Gatwick (operated by Boeing 787 Dreamliner)

What Is the Air Peace Baggage Policy?

  • Carry-on baggage: One piece up to 6 kg, plus one small personal item (handbag or laptop bag)
  • Checked baggage (Economy domestic): Typically 20 kg
  • Checked baggage (Economy international): Typically 30 kg on most international routes
  • Checked baggage (Business Class): Up to 40 kg
  • Excess baggage: Charged per kilogram — pre-purchasing through Travelwings at the time of Air Peace booking is more economical than airport rates
  • Infants: Limited baggage allowance plus one collapsible stroller or car seat

What Check-In Options Are Available on Air Peace?

  • Online check-in: Available 24 hours to 4 hours before scheduled departure via the Air Peace website and mobile app
  • Airport check-in: Counters open 3 hours before international flights and 2 hours before domestic departures
  • Recommended arrival: 2 hours before domestic flights and 3 hours before international departures
  • Required documents: Valid government-issued photo ID for domestic flights; passport (and visa where applicable) for international flights

What Should You Know About Air Peace's Long-Haul Lagos–London Gatwick Service?

Air Peace's flagship international service is the daily Lagos–London Gatwick route, operated by Boeing 787 Dreamliner aircraft. The route features full Business Class service with lie-flat beds, enhanced baggage allowance, and a competitive product for Nigerian travellers compared with British Airways and Virgin Atlantic on the same corridor.
